After 45 years of engagement with Britten's Cello Suites, Pieter Wispelwey () releases a new recording of Benjamin Britten's three solo works for cello on the Evil Penguin Records label to critical acclaim. 🎶

BBC Music Magazine *****

"This latest version from Wispelwey feels very much like a masterful resume of ideas culled over 45 years playing these suites […] Wispelwey is the captivating storyteller who knows the twists of the plot – knows the sadness, knows the levity. Just knows.”

Gramophone Magazine: Editor’s Choice

"a fascinating journey, which this cellist's admirers will enjoy following."

Süddeutsche Zeitung

"Overall, a recording of these haunting solo cello monologues that is gripping and sets new standards in every respect – truly "grand repertoire," as Pieter Wispelwey puts it."

Pizzicato Magazine

"With a light touch and a sure instinct, Wispelwey succeeds in bringing out the characteristics of the works. (…) Above all, Wispelwey delivers an interpretation that has grown from within, evoking moods that seem almost improvisational."

Magazin O-Ton

“An important tribute to an important composer of the 20th century!”

Di**le Yandell makes his Royal Ballet and opera debut this evening as Masetto in Mozart's Don Giovanni.

This house debut follows a highly successful summer at Glyndebourne Festival as Mr Redburn in Britten's Billy Budd, and opens a season in which Di**le will return to Glyndebourne as Zuniga in Bizet's Carmen.

Rayfield Allied is delighted to welcome bass-baritone Andrew Foster-Williams for general management.

Described by Opera Now "I could listen to Andrew Foster-Williams’ voice all day, bold, commanding, clear and enigmatic...”

Foster-Williams has carved out a distinguished international career playing a wide range of operatic roles, each brought to life with vocal authority, dramatic insight, and stylistic finesse. His artistry is defined not only by the breadth of his repertoire but by the depth with which he inhabits each role whether villainous, noble, comedic or tragically complex.

Helen Charlston's most recent release with BIS, 'A Poet's Love' has been awarded the German Critics' Lieder and Vocal Recital Award for Q3 2026.

Jury member, Albrecht Thiemann, described the recording as 'dreamlike', praising Charlston's 'unforced lyricism and compelling intensity'.

Since its release in May of this year, the album has received glowing reviews across the board, with five-star ratings from BBC Music Magazine and The Times.

Today, Steve Reich’s newest work – In All Your Ways – is premiered at Edinburgh International Festival ahead of worldwide celebrations for the composer’s 90th birthday in October.

Performed by long-standing collaborators the Colin Currie Group, the new work co-commissioned by the Festival is scored for a classic Reich large ensemble line-up of double flutes and clarinets, mallet percussion, piano duo and string quartet.
